Cypress Grove RV Park Introduce
Cypress Grove RV Park is a charming and serene destination nestled in the scenic Rogue Valley, located at 1679 Rogue River Hwy, Gold Hill, OR 97525. This well-maintained RV park offers a cozy environment for both full-time residents and transient travelers seeking a quiet retreat. With its clean facilities, friendly staff, and convenient location near outdoor activities, Cypress Grove RV Park is a perfect choice for those looking to enjoy the beauty of Oregon while experiencing a comfortable and safe community.
The park boasts a welcoming atmosphere, with many long-term residents who appreciate the peaceful setting and sense of community. retirees particularly love the quiet, clean environment that allows them to relax and enjoy their golden years in comfort. While the park is 15 miles from Eagle Point, it provides easy access to nearby attractions like hiking trails, fishing spots, and other outdoor activities.

My dad lives here and he said it's very quiet and clean, he loves living there. Just wishes it was a bit closer to Eagle Point because that's where I live and he comes over a lot. But, even then, it's 15 miles from my house. Every time I have been there, it is clean and quiet. Perfect place for retired folk
My husband and I were traveling in our car and our back tire blew out. We pulled over by the RV park parking lot and camp host/resident Rod Bennett introduced himself and helped us change our tire. He was very helpful and courteous. We just thought we’d put in a good word because he took the time to help us.
This place was nice and clean Everyone is so helpful and courtesy. Helped get us in our spot, directed us to the laundry room. Also, Ron was awesome. He got our cable up and going offered a better cable. Great conversation about the area. The park is beautiful and right off the highway. Easy accessible. I would come back here anytime
We love this park. We took a spot for one month but had to leave after 2 weeks because of the smoke from the fires in the forest near by. The managers gave us credit for the days not used so we are back and are loving it. It is a beautiful park with flowers and beautiful lawns, so well kept. I can't say enough good for the managers, and also the assistant manager. They are friendly and helpful. We would certainly stay here again and would recommend this park to anyone who wants a place for a night, a week or a month. Again I say we love this park.
What a pleasant surprise and a great find... I am a Snowbird and normally overnight at Valley of the Rouge State Park during my migrations. This time I stayed at Cypress Cove. Everything about this park was nice. surprisingly the majority of the tenants are long-term but the RVs and the sites are clean and proper, everybody was friendly... A big plus for me is that it was quiet.. it definitely will be my Choice in the future.
